Runbook: Extracting the User Module from Grindelwald Core

Step 3 covers dual-write verification. After the new users-service is deployed, both it and the monolith write to the interim bridge schema. Reviewers should confirm the comparison job reports zero divergent rows for 48 hours before we cut reads over. Do not approve the read-cutover PR until that window passes. Verify the bridge schema manually using the connection string below.

warehouse DSN: mssql://rusdor_svc:0FSWCn9@db-951a.paliqforge.local:5432/ulawyn

- [ ] **Graphlet visualizer: verify render parity.** Confirm the Tanglewood dependency graph visualizer renders identical node layouts between the staging and release artifacts, including the new cycle-highlight overlay added by the Corvid team. Reviewer should diff the exported SVG snapshots and sign off in the release channel before the artifact is promoted. The candidate artifact under review is identified by the token below.

build token for fajof-yahof: htk4_869f

Subject: Cut-over summary — KioskGuard watchdog

Hi Marisol,

The cut-over for the Pavilion kiosk fleet completed at 03:10 without rollback. The new watchdog now restarts the shell within four seconds of a hang, and we verified heartbeat logging on twelve units in the Delverton lobby. One unit needed a manual reboot; root cause pending. The watchdog service now runs with the following configuration values.

settings of bawif-fawif:
ralix:
  log_level: warn
  metrics_host: metrics.ralix.tolvaqsys.internal
  pool_size: 32